CXH vs FDP: Which Is the Better Dividend Stock?

As of July 2026, FDP (Del Monte Corporation) screens as the stronger dividend stock, winning 5 of 6 head-to-head metrics. CXH offers the higher yield at 8.94%, FDP has the higher dividend-safety score, and FDP trades at the larger discount to fair value (+116%).
